What was the New Amsterdam?The colonial capital of New Netherland was located in New Amsterdam, a 17th-century Dutch town built on the southern tip of Manhattan Island. The neighborhood around Fort Amsterdam was developed as a result of the early trading factory. The fort was built to protect the Dutch West India Company's fur trading operations in the North River and was strategically located on the southern tip of Manhattan Island (Hudson River). In 1624, it became a provincial extension of the Dutch Republic and was named as the seat of the province in 1625. A private, for-profit business focused on forming alliances and doing business with the regional Native American ethnic groups, New Netherland was initially a territory.

What was the economy of Sparta?The economy of Sparta was based on farming and conquest. Spartans stole the land they required from their neighbors because Sparta lacked sufficient land to feed its whole population. Sparta used slaves and outsiders to create necessities since Spartan men spent their entire lives as warriors.
Even though Sparta's soil was rich, there wasn't enough land there to feed everyone. Spartans occasionally stole the lands they need from their neighbors, who were then made to labor for Sparta.

Impeachment is the process of removing the president from office. The House of Representatives proposes it, and the Senate has to agree/disagree with it.
The Senate becomes jury and judge, except in the case of presidential impeachment trials when the chief justice of the United States presides. The Constitution requires a two-thirds vote of the Senate to convict, and the penalty for an impeached official is removal from office. The Constitution gives the House of Representatives the sole power to impeach an official, and it makes the Senate the sole court for impeachment trials.

What is the Securities and Exchange Commission?
The autonomous U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ission was founded by the federal government of the United States in the wake of the 1929 Wall Street Crash. Maintaining the legislation against market manipulation is the SEC's primary objective.
The Securities and Exchange Commission oversees securities exchanges, investment advisors, securities brokers and dealers, and mutual funds in an effort to promote moral business conduct, the release of crucial market information, and the avoidance of fraud.

What are the consequences faced by Articles of Confederation ?
The federal government was only allowed to ask the states for money, not directly tax the people.Rare state financial contributions prevented the federal government from meeting its obligations or funding programs.International or intrastate trade could not be regulated by the national government.The federal government was powerless to stop states from undermining it by negotiating their own trade deals with other countries.The central authority could only ask the states to deploy soldiers; it could not establish an army.States' refusal to send troops might make it challenging to safeguard the country.No matter how many people lived there, each state only had one vote in Congress.Political power was proportionately greater among residents of tiny states than large states.To learn more about Articles of Confederation checkout the link below :
